Achatinella-pulcherrima Definition


A taxonomic species within the genus Achatinella — a species of gastropod which is endemic to Oahu in the US Hawaiian islands and currently an endangered species.


Find Similar Words

Find similar words to achatinella-pulcherrima using the buttons below.

Words Starting With

Words Ending With

Word Length

Words Near Achatinella-pulcherrima in the Dictionary